Output 6902d7e26a89ceb8dfdb364d30938120682cdbce2dfde50b2c79d4c8e0a16a49:10

value
1070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 820ecc0f8c8a0caed211274a7013d8e194ab272f OP_EQUAL
address
3DYhVbw4CMdwQhn8K1qSRLE3xbpKF9TsEq
transaction
6902d7e26a89ceb8dfdb364d30938120682cdbce2dfde50b2c79d4c8e0a16a49
spent
true